What Twin City Security, Inc. Does

Founded in 1972 and based in Denver, Colorado, Twin City Security, Inc. is a established regional provider of physical security and investigation services. With a workforce of 501-1000 employees, the company likely offers a range of services including uniformed security guards, mobile patrols, access control, and event security for commercial and residential clients across the Front Range and potentially beyond. As a mid-market player in a traditional, people-intensive industry, its operations are fundamentally built on human vigilance and procedural execution.

Why AI Matters at This Scale

For a company of Twin City Security's size in the security sector, AI presents a pivotal opportunity to transition from a reactive, labor-cost-centric model to a proactive, intelligence-driven service. The industry faces persistent pressures: thin margins, high employee turnover, and the constant challenge of demonstrating value beyond a physical presence. At the 500+ employee scale, even small efficiency gains in scheduling, reporting, or monitoring translate into significant operational savings and scalability. Furthermore, clients increasingly expect data-driven insights into their security posture, not just hourly logs. AI enables this mid-market firm to compete with larger nationals by offering sophisticated, tech-augmented services without necessarily matching their vast capital resources, allowing for premium service differentiation.

Concrete AI Opportunities with ROI Framing

1. Automated Threat Detection via Video Analytics: Integrating AI video analytics into existing camera infrastructure can monitor feeds 24/7 for specific behaviors (e.g., perimeter breaches, unattended objects). The ROI is clear: it reduces the need for dedicated monitoring personnel, enables faster response times to real incidents (potentially reducing liability), and provides auditable evidence for clients, strengthening contract renewals and justifying rate premiums.

2. Data-Driven Patrol Optimization: By analyzing historical incident reports, police data, and time-stamped patrol logs, machine learning models can predict higher-risk times and locations. This allows for dynamic, optimized patrol routes. The ROI manifests as more efficient use of guard hours, increased deterrence in proven hotspots (leading to fewer incidents and happier clients), and fuel savings for mobile patrol vehicles.

3. Intelligent Scheduling and Dispatch: AI algorithms can factor in guard certifications, shift preferences, client site requirements, and traffic conditions to create optimal schedules and dispatch the nearest qualified guard to alarm calls. This directly attacks major cost centers: overtime pay due to poor scheduling and response latency. The ROI includes reduced labor costs, lower turnover from better shift management, and improved service level agreement compliance.

Deployment Risks Specific to This Size Band

For a mid-market company like Twin City Security, deployment risks are distinct. Integration Complexity is high, as any AI solution must work with legacy systems like access control panels, time clocks, and basic reporting software, requiring careful API management or middleware. Skill Gap is acute; the company likely lacks dedicated data scientists or ML engineers, making it reliant on vendor solutions or consultants, which can lead to vendor lock-in and unclear long-term maintenance costs. Change Management is monumental. Introducing AI monitoring can be perceived as a lack of trust in guards' abilities, risking morale and union pushback. A successful rollout requires transparent communication that AI is a tool to make guards' jobs safer and more strategic, not to replace them. Finally, Data Governance becomes critical; handling sensitive video and personal data requires robust cybersecurity measures and compliance expertise that may stretch existing IT resources.
